Legal action against this is going to be a tough, possibly unfeasable battle. Whatever the laws are, they probably contain exceptions for the use of biometrics for law enforcement purposes. In terms of court precedent, biometrics are not protected by the 4th amendment, because your face is not considered a secret that the government could compel you to reveal.

I'm not sure what documents you think entail getting a REAL ID but they are typically proof of permanent residence, such as US passport, birth certificate, or green card. Its requirements are actually stricter than what entails getting a passport, because you also have to prove you actually live in the state you're applying in.
